Sherrod Brown Triumphs in Ohio Democratic Primary
Former U.S. Senator Sherrod Brown won the Ohio Democratic primary election on Tuesday, setting the stage for a bid to reclaim the seat he lost in 2024. His victory was reported by the Associated Press and NBC News, indicating strong support within the party.
Former U.S. Senator Sherrod Brown has emerged victorious in the Ohio Democratic primary election held on Tuesday. This win marks a significant step in Brown's quest to regain the Senate seat he held until his reelection defeat in 2024.
The Associated Press and NBC News have reported Brown's win, highlighting his continued influence and support within the Democratic Party as well as among Ohio voters.
As Brown gears up for the general election, his successful primary campaign indicates robust backing despite previous setbacks, positioning him as a key player in the upcoming electoral race.
